Transaction 3af8f598eda377464d955161414a0bff1571a1e0c78021678daa24426c8a18bd
1 Input
1 Output
-
3af8f598eda377464d955161414a0bff1571a1e0c78021678daa24426c8a18bd:0
- value
- 17617201
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d08f6d525b2974197a42da16055d5f0f4b0ff1a OP_EQUALVERIFY OP_CHECKSIG
- address
- LZYH6Azy23QXVaGcodX7CBSXFe3wbXHvqt